LovableSEO is the fastest way to add SEO to your Lovable website. Lovable sites are often invisible to search engines because Lovable has no native CMS, limited metadata controls, and no built-in SEO tools. LovableSEO fixes this in about 5 minutes.

How it works: • Zero code changes — Update your DNS records to point your domain to our SEO proxy. No changes required to your Lovable app. • Make your entire site crawlable — Search engines see prerendered HTML. Human visitors see your Lovable app at full speed. • Auto-publish content that ranks — Add a real blog at /blog with SEO-optimized articles, topic clusters, and internal linking. • Instant indexing — Get found on Google and AI search engines without a CMS.

LovableSEO is built specifically for Lovable websites. Setup takes about 5 minutes, and your app’s performance and uptime are unaffected. Get found on Google in minutes.

ExpressJS features and specs

  • Fast Setup
    ExpressJS provides a minimal and flexible framework that allows rapid setup and development of web and mobile applications.
  • Middleware Support
    ExpressJS has a robust middleware system, allowing developers to add reusable functions to the request-handling pipeline.
  • Extensibility
    ExpressJS is highly extensible through third-party libraries and built-in functionality, catering to the needs of various applications.
  • Performance
    Due to its minimalist core, ExpressJS provides efficient performance and is capable of handling a high number of requests per second.
  • Community and Ecosystem
    A large and active community provides extensive documentation, support, and a wide array of open-source packages to extend functionality.
  • Flexibility
    Compared to full-stack frameworks, ExpressJS gives developers the freedom to structure their applications as they see fit.
  • Compatibility
    ExpressJS works seamlessly with various template engines, databases, and other frameworks, making it versatile for different project requirements.

Possible disadvantages of ExpressJS

  • Minimalist Core
    The minimalist nature of ExpressJS may require additional time and effort to integrate required plugins and libraries for specific features.
  • Learning Curve
    While ExpressJS is straightforward, mastering the middleware pattern and effective usage can have a learning curve for new developers.
  • Callback Hell
    Developers can encounter 'callback hell' due to nested callback functions, though this can be mitigated using Promises and async/await in modern JavaScript.
  • Lack of Convention
    Unlike opinionated frameworks, ExpressJS lacks conventions, which can lead to inconsistent code structure and maintenance challenges across different projects.
  • Security
    ExpressJS does not have built-in security features and relies on third-party solutions, requiring developers to be vigilant about applying best security practices.
  • Scalability
    While ExpressJS can handle high traffic, building and maintaining a highly scalable application might require significant additional effort, particularly in terms of codebase organization and resource management.

Analysis of ExpressJS

Overall verdict

  • ExpressJS is a highly recommended option for building web applications with Node.js. Its simplicity, extensive middleware options, and strong community support make it a solid choice for both beginners and experienced developers. However, it might not be the best fit for highly complex applications that require more opinionated frameworks with more built-in features.

Why this product is good

  • ExpressJS is a minimalist and flexible web application framework for Node.js. It provides a robust set of features for building web and mobile applications, making it a popular choice among developers.
  • It offers a thin layer of fundamental web application features, without obscuring Node.js features that developers use regularly.
  • ExpressJS has a large ecosystem of middleware to handle various tasks such as security, session management, and file uploads, which simplifies the development process.
  • It's known for its fast learning curve, which makes it particularly advantageous for developers who are new to backend web development but familiar with JavaScript.

  • Meteor 3.5: accounts-express Brings Meteor Accounts to Express
    Express is a practical fit for REST endpoints, webhooks, third-party integrations, and server APIs. But those endpoints often need the authenticated Meteor user, existing authorization rules, and access to private application data. Before accounts-express, bridging that boundary could mean custom middleware, manual token handling, or a parallel authentication model around Express. - Source: dev.to / 18 days ago

  • GraphQL vs REST: 18 Claims Fact-Checked with Primary Sources (2026)
    Many REST frameworks also ship with limited security controls enabled by default. Express.js , a minimal web framework, does not include rate limiting or input validation out of the box and relies on middleware for these concerns. Django REST Framework includes throttling features, but they are not enabled by default. - Source: dev.to / 5 months ago
